Block 509,103

Block Hash

0658292021f0c1b2f30a24fea06b78a7b9c2dc96c9759cbf47b9279d8a8e368d

Previous Block Hash

57beb0976b8a0d0e052378867229020320edc256527e14dd2e142ca04da4ac5d

Mined

Transactions

4

Difficulty

40.16 M

Size

848 bytes

Transactions (4)

1 input, 1 output
15,625.05452 PEPE
1 input, 2 outputs
175,704.53795588 PEPE
1 input, 2 outputs
2,386.0225 PEPE
1 input, 2 outputs
2,382.02024 PEPE